Tottenham Hotspur Target Etete Not Ruling Out Playing For Nigeria
Published: March 23, 2019Tottenham Hotspur target Kion Etete, 17, has not ruled out the possibility of representing the Nigerian National Teams in the near future.
The uncapped Notts County wonderkid is eligible to turn out for Nigeria through his father and the striker can also play for the Young Lions as he has an English mom and was born in Derbyshire, England.
Nigerians back home began to take notice of Etete earlier this month after he netted a brace for Tottenham Hotspur U18s vs West Ham while undergoing trial with the North London club.
''I only played grassroots football before I join Notts County,'' said Kion Etete to allnigeriasoccer.com.
''I’m eligible to represent England and Nigeria maybe one other I’m not sure and it would be an honour (to play for Nigeria) but would have to consult with my parents before making a decision.''
When asked to highlight his qualities, Etete said : ''I’d like to think that I’m a quick, strong striker and love taking shots at goal.
''In the next five years I want to be playing regular first team football at the highest level I possibly can''.
Etete made his first-team debut for Notts County aged just sixteen and has six appearances to his name so far this season.
